#215658 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#215658 is composed of 12.9% red, 33.7%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 62.5% cyan, 2.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 65.5% black. It has a hue angle of 182.2 degrees, a saturation of 45.5% and a lightness of 23.7%. #215658 color hex could be obtained by blending #42acb0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

#215658 color description : Very dark cyan.

#215658 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#215658 has RGB values of R:33, G:86,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0.63, M:0.02, Y:0, K:0.65. Its decimal value is 2184792.

Shades and Tints of #215658

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010202 is the darkest color, while #f3fafb is the lightest one.

Tones of #215658

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#384041 is the less saturated color, while #007479 is the most saturated one.
